    I have lived at Summit Terrace in a one-bedroom for three years - one as a graduate student, and…read moretwo as a working professional. Overall, I have been extremely satisfied with my experience. The staff are friendly, and have always responded quickly to my requests for maintenance assistance. They happily replaced my refrigerator after issues with the freezer keeping it cold. I've also enjoyed the pool - it is well-kept, and open from around Memorial Day through Labor Day. The laundry room is generally clean, and I've never had a problem with machine availability. Currently, at $1.25 per load the cost proves manageable. I wish the laundry room were open 24/7, but have certainly been able to work with the 8am-10pm hours. You can walk to downtown in about 10 minutes, and BGSU is a 20-25-minute walk, a c. 10-minute bike ride, or 5-minute drive away. Summit Terrace also offers a shuttle service to campus and possibly a few other locations??, which I have not used extensively but would certainly be a plus for those without a car. Mostly students, young families, and some retired folks live here. The atmosphere is generally quiet and friendly, which I have appreciated! Feels safe, my apartment is quite spacious, and rent is reasonable for the quality of living. I would definitely recommend Summit Terrace as an ideal BG apartment complex!
